Agreement No.3192201 (23-0378-38520) <br /> ARTICLE IV <br /> PAYMENT <br /> 4.1 Availability of Appropriation; Sufficiency of Funds. This Agreement is contingent upon and subject to the <br /> availability of sufficient funds. Grantor may terminate or suspend this Agreement, in whole or in part, without penalty or <br /> further payment being required, if(i)sufficient funds for this Agreement have not been appropriated or otherwise made <br /> available to the Grantor by the State or the federal funding source, (ii)the Governor or Grantor reserves funds, or(iii)the <br /> Governor or Grantor determines that funds will not or may not be available for payment. Grantor shall provide notice, in <br /> writing, to Grantee of any such funding failure and its election to terminate or suspend this Agreement as soon as <br /> practicable. Any suspension or termination pursuant to this Section will be effective upon the date of the written notice <br /> unless otherwise indicated. <br /> 4.2. Pre-Award Costs. Pre-award costs are not permitted unless specifically authorized by the Grantor in Exhibit <br /> A, PART TWO, or PART THREE of this Agreement. If they are authorized, pre-award costs must be charged to the initial <br /> Budget Period of the Award, unless otherwise specified by the Grantor. 2 CFR 200.458. <br /> 4.3 Return of Grant Funds. Any Grant Funds remaining that are not expended or legally obligated by Grantee, <br /> including those funds obligated pursuant to ARTICLE XVII, at the end of the Agreement period, or in the case of capital <br /> improvement Awards at the end of the time period Grant Funds are available for expenditure or obligation, shall be <br /> returned to Grantor within forty-five (45) days. A Grantee who is required to reimburse Grant Funds and who enters into a <br /> deferred payment plan for the purpose of satisfying a past due debt, shall be required to pay interest on such debt as <br /> required by Section 10.2 of the Illinois State Collection Act of 1986. 30 ILCS 210; 44 III.Admin. Code 7000.450(c). In <br /> addition, as required by 44 III. Admin. Code 7000.440(b)(2), unless granted a written extension, Grantee must liquidate all <br /> obligations incurred under the Award at the end of the period of performance. <br /> 4.4 Cash Management Improvement Act of 1990. Unless notified otherwise in PART TWO or PART THREE, <br /> federal funds received under this Agreement shall be managed in accordance with the Cash Management Improvement <br /> Act of 1990 (31 USC 6501 et seq.)and any other applicable federal laws or regulations. 2 CFR 200.305; 44 III. Admin. <br /> Code 7000.120. <br /> 4.5 Payments to Third Parties. Grantee agrees that Grantor shall have no liability to Grantee when Grantor acts <br /> in good faith to redirect all or a portion of any Grantee payment to a third party. Grantor will be deemed to have acted in <br /> good faith when it is in possession of information that indicates Grantee authorized Grantor to intercept or redirect <br /> payments to a third party or when so ordered by a court of competent jurisdiction. <br /> 4.6 Modifications to Estimated Amount. If the Agreement amount is established on an estimated basis, then it <br /> may be increased by mutual agreement at any time during the Term. Grantor may decrease the estimated amount of this <br /> Agreement at any time during the Term if(i) Grantor believes Grantee will not use the funds during the Term, (ii)Grantor <br /> believes Grantee has used funds in a manner that was not authorized by this Agreement, (iii) sufficient funds for this <br /> Agreement have not been appropriated or otherwise made available to the Grantor by the State or the federal funding <br /> source, (iv)the Governor or Grantor reserves funds, or(v)the Governor or Grantor determines that funds will or may not <br /> be available for payment. Grantee will be notified, in writing, of any adjustment of the estimated amount of this <br /> Agreement.
